Output 680c6130dce87a5830f8b36fb937754bf2149303da7743e17ea2233c359ede5c:18

value
568336
script pubkey
OP_0 OP_PUSHBYTES_20 052b27fac4c1c400227b524986f8a9d57adfd850
address
bc1qq54j07kyc8zqqgnm2fycd79f64adlkzs25ddw7
transaction
680c6130dce87a5830f8b36fb937754bf2149303da7743e17ea2233c359ede5c
spent
true